Target
-
Function
Implicated in commitment to and/or differentiation of the myocardial lineage. Acts as a transcriptional activator of ANF in cooperation with GATA4 (By similarity). It is transcriptionally controlled by PBX1 and acts as a transcriptional repressor of CDKN2B (By similarity). It is required for spleen development. -
Tissue specificity
Expressed only in the heart. -
Involvement in disease
Atrial septal defect 7, with or without atrioventricular conduction defects
Tetralogy of Fallot
Conotruncal heart malformations
Hypothyroidism, congenital, non-goitrous, 5
Ventricular septal defect 3
Hypoplastic left heart syndrome 2
Asplenia, isolated congenital -
Sequence similarities
Belongs to the NK-2 homeobox family.
Contains 1 homeobox DNA-binding domain. -
Cellular localization
Nucleus. - Information by UniProt
